Once you have passed the last frost date and soil temperatures have warmed to 55-60 degrees, it's time to grow dahlias. Plant dahlia tubers 18 to 24 inches apart, at a depth of 4 to 6 inches. Name: dahlia, Dahlia species.. Height: from dwarf 40cm to 1.5–2m giants. Climate: prefers warm temperate, but can be grown in all climates.In cold areas, plant when threat of frost has passed.
